12. Introduction to effects and typography (Day 10)

In today's live lecture, we delved into the captivating world of Effects and Animations, as well as Typography. While this might sound intricate at first, rest assured that with a bit of practice, it can become a skill you can comfortably add to your web design toolkit.

The tutor showed us:

Hover-Activated Resizing: We witnessed a simple yet eye-catching effect - a red box that gracefully expanded in size when the cursor hovered over it. This not only adds a touch of interactivity but also provides an elegant way to engage visitors.

Image Pop-Out with Shadows: Three images lined up side by side came to life as we hovered our cursor over them. They gracefully popped out with a subtle dark shadow, imparting depth and dimension to the page. It's a clever way to draw attention to important visuals.

Auto-elongating Element: Another intriguing animation involved a red box that elongated on its own over time. This effect offers a dynamic feel to your website, making it less static and more engaging.

Typing Effect: The lecture also showcased a cursor diligently typing out a sentence, word by word, mimicking the typing effect often seen on blogs and apps. This subtle animation can bring your text content to life.
